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Q: Do I need an expert to put together a home treadmill?
A: Most mid-range to high-end treadmills get here partly assembled, however putting them together usually needs two people. Brands like JTX and NordicTrack use white-glove delivery and assembly services for an additional fee, which is frequently worth it to conserve time and make sure security.
Q: How much space do I need around a treadmill?
A: For security reasons, manufacturers typically suggest leaving a minimum of 2 meters of clear area behind the treadmill and 0.5 meters on each side. This prevents injury if you take place to slip or journey backward off the belt.

Q: Can I use any treadmill with Zwift?
A: Not instantly. To link to Zwift or Kinomap, your treadmill either needs integrated Bluetooth FTMS (Fitness Machine Service) connection or you need to attach a Runn sensing unit to the treadmill belt to track your speed. Always inspect compatibility requirements before buying if virtual racing is a top priority.
